Ontario finds no appreciable benefit from privatized prison.


Ontario had "no appreciable benefit" from the private operation of a correctional facility, Community Safety and Correctional Services Minister Monte Kwinter Monte Kwinter (born March 22, 1931 in Toronto, Ontario) is a politician in Ontario, Canada. He announced that the operation of Central North Correctional Centre in Penetanguishene would be placed in the public sector, ending the province's five year experiment with a private firm, Management and Training Corporation Canada.

The province created a pilot project to compare the performance of the Central North facility with the publicly operated Central East Correctional Centre in Kawartha Lakes Kawartha Lakes (kəwôr`thə), group of 14 lakes, in a region c.50 mi (80 km) long and c.25 mi (40 km) wide, S Ont., Canada, near the towns of Lindsay and Peterborough. The two facilities are the same in size and design, including 1,184-bed multi-purpose correctional facilities, and a 32-bed female unit. Both facilities are maximum security institutions. Management and Training Corporation Canada was chosen by the previous Conservative government to operate the Central North Correctional Centre in May 2001 as part of a five-year pilot project. During that period, the Central East Correctional Centre reopened as a publicly operated facility. The contract with MTCC ends on November 10. Over the next six months, the ministry will work with MTCC and the labour unions on the transfer of operations to the Ontario Public Service.
